Seven suspects, who are members of a highway robbery syndicate believed to be behind a lot of robberies has been arrested by the Accra Regional Police Command, in collaboration with the Eastern Regional Police Command, the police confirmed in a statement on Saturday.
In a statement signed by Superintendent Juliana Obeng, Head of Public Affairs for the Accra Region, observed that the suspects have been linked to several previous robbery cases, including attacks on market women, motorists, and a fatal robbery incident in which a driver lost his life.
“Police investigations have so far resulted in the arrest and detention of seven suspects, including one who is on admission receiving medical attention. The suspects in custody are Salia Mohammed, alias Kwaku Duah, aged 27; Kofi Ishmael, alias Ishmael Addo, alias Kofi Ketewa, aged 32; Kwame Bediako, alias Star Boy, alias Nkokorpor, identified as the ringleader of the gang; Kwadwo Kalovi, alias Aticho; Mumuni Abdul Razak, alias Mogambo, aged 39; Kwasi Akambuley, alias Kwasi Fresh, aged 27; and Kwame Bonsu, alias Killer Ntua,” said the statement.
Exhibits retrieved so far by the police include firearms, ammunition, machetes, knives, mobile phones, and other items suspected to be proceeds of crime.
According to the Police on November 29, 2025, the suspects attacked a residence at Peduase and robbed the occupants of mobile phones, jewellery, and an unsuspected amount of cash while armed with firearms.
Following intelligence-led investigations, the statement said personnel from the Eastern Regional Police Intelligence Directorate (PID), in collaboration with the Accra Regional PID arrested suspect Kofi Ishmael, aged 30, on January 6 this year at Avenor, a suburb of Accra.
According to the police, the suspect admitted to his involvement in the robbery and subsequently identified Kwame Bediako, alias Star Boy, as the ringleader of the gang during interrogation.
Acting on the information obtained, the police arrested Kwame Bediako at Ablekuma Agape, and a search conducted at his residence led to the retrieval of a pump-action gun concealed within the fence wall, together with four BB cartridges. The suspect was said to have admitted his involvement in several robbery cases.
According to the police, further investigations revealed that the suspects were involved in multiple highway robberies targeting motorists and trailer drivers along the Accra-Tema Motorway, Achimota Forest Road, Pokuase, Amasaman, Suhum, Nkawkaw, and the Juaso-Kumasi stretch.
